Transaction 381c64bd5fa87d93520b22a14574ad85d2c05e3c63f334de08bb14437e58c4aa
1 Input
1 Output
-
381c64bd5fa87d93520b22a14574ad85d2c05e3c63f334de08bb14437e58c4aa:0
- value
- 571396
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 fdd53e2411b2184419c7c78cfb4e281bab5586736525a7ecbd790a923ade7c99
- address
- bc1plh2nufq3kgvygxw8c7x0kn3grw44tpnnv5j60m9a0y9fywk70jvsjamxye